View moreDLA Land and Maritime issued this pre-solicitation notice, identified by solicitation number SPE7MX19R0051, for the procurement of Mast Section Antennas (NSN 5985-00-115-7149). This requirement falls under NAICS code 334220 for Radio and Television Broadcasting and Wireless Communications Equipment Manufacturing and PSC 59. The government intends to establish a firm-fixed-price, indefinite delivery contract with a three-year base period and two additional option years. The total value of the contract is not to exceed $2,576,845.98, supporting an estimated annual demand quantity of 19,861 units.
The acquisition is restricted to approved sources under the authority of 10 U.S.C. 2304(c)(1) because the government lacks complete, unrestrictive technical data. Identified approved sources include Autodyne Manufacturing Co., Inc., Century Metal Parts, Co., and Arnold A. Semler, Inc. dba Associated Industries. The small business size standard for this procurement is 1,250 employees. Evaluation for the final award decision will consider a combination of price, delivery, and past performance.
The solicitation is expected to be released on or about June 1, 2019, which is also the established response deadline. Deliveries are scheduled for 155 days via DLA Direct shipping to stock.
